How To Fix AD833 - & & cannot be saved


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: AD - Data Dictionary application messages

  • Message number: 833

  • Message text: & & cannot be saved

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message AD833 - & & cannot be saved ?

    The SAP error message AD833 typically indicates that there is an issue with saving a document or data in the system. The specific message "AD833 & & cannot be saved" suggests that there is a problem related to the data being processed, which could be due to various reasons. Here are some common causes, potential solutions, and related information for this error:

    Causes:

    1. Data Validation Issues: The data being entered may not meet the required validation rules set in the system. This could include incorrect formats, missing mandatory fields, or invalid values.

    2. Authorization Problems: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to save the document or data in the system.

    3. Technical Issues: There could be underlying technical issues, such as database locks, system performance problems, or issues with the application server.

    4. Custom Code or Enhancements: If there are custom developments or enhancements in the system, they might be causing conflicts or errors during the save process.

    5. Configuration Errors: Incorrect configuration settings in the relevant modules could lead to this error.

    Solutions:

    1. Check Data Input: Review the data being entered for any errors or omissions. Ensure that all mandatory fields are filled out correctly and that the data adheres to the expected formats.

    2. Review Authorizations: Verify that the user has the necessary permissions to perform the action. This can be done by checking the user roles and authorizations in the system.

    3. Check for Locks: Use transaction codes like SM12 to check for any locks on the database that might be preventing the save operation. If locks are found, they may need to be released.

    4. Debugging: If you have access to debugging tools, you can analyze the program or transaction to identify where the error is occurring. This may require the assistance of a developer.

    5. Consult Logs: Check the system logs (transaction SLG1) for any additional error messages or warnings that could provide more context about the issue.

    6. Contact Support: If the issue persists and cannot be resolved through the above steps, consider reaching out to SAP support or your internal IT support team for further assistance.
